What companies run services between Adelaide, SA, Australia and Murtoa, VIC, Australia?
V-Line Buses operates a bus from 85 Franklin St to McDonald St/Marma St once daily. Tickets cost $6–40 and the journey takes 6h 40m. Alternatively, Journey Beyond - The Overland operates a train from Adelaide Station to Horsham Station twice a week. Tickets cost $90–230 and the journey takes 5h 44m.
